How Alachua County Sheriff's Office Phone Line for Crime Tips and Emergencies Actually Works
Understanding how a non-emergency line functions is simple once you break it down. The primary purpose of the Alachua County Sheriff's Office Phone Line for Crime Tips and Emergencies is to handle calls that do not require an immediate police response. This includes reporting suspicious behavior that is not currently happening, providing information about past incidents, or asking general questions about local safety procedures. When you call, you will typically speak with a dispatcher who logs your information into a database.
For someone making a report, the process is designed to be straightforward and user-friendly. You will be asked for basic details such as your name (which can remain anonymous if you prefer), a description of what you observed, and the location. If you are using the Alachua County Sheriff's Office Phone Line for Crime Tips and Emergencies for a non-urgent matter, you should not expect an officer to rush to your location immediately. Instead, the information you provide is reviewed by patrol supervisors. They use it to identify patterns, schedule patrols in specific areas, or investigate trends over time.
Imagine a scenario where a resident notices unfamiliar vehicles parked late at night in a quiet neighborhood. By calling the non-emergency number, they can provide details like the license plate or description of the driver without tying up an emergency line. This tip might seem small to the individual, but it can contribute to a larger picture for the department. The Alachua County Sheriff's Office Phone Line for Crime Tips and Emergencies acts as a channel for these small pieces of information, helping the agency allocate its resources intelligently and maintain a visible presence where it is needed most.

What Should I Use This Line For Exactly?
The main function of this number is for non-urgent communication. You should call it to report a crime that is not currently in progress, provide general information, or ask questions about local policies. If you are witnessing a crime happening right now or someone is in immediate danger, you should always call 911. The Alachua County Sheriff's Office Phone Line for Crime Tips and Emergencies is specifically separated from emergency lines to ensure that life-threatening situations receive the fastest possible response.
Is My Information Kept Confidential?
Yes, the department places a high value on the confidentiality of its tipsters. When you use the Alachua County Sheriff's Office Phone Line for Crime Tips and Emergencies, you have the option to remain anonymous. Dispatchers are trained to respect this request and will not press you for identification unless it is absolutely necessary for the investigation. This confidentiality is a critical factor in encouraging people to come forward with information they might otherwise keep to themselves.

How Quickly Will I Hear Back?
Because this is a non-emergency line, the expectation for a callback is different from a 911 call. You may not receive an immediate return call, as officers may be actively patrolling or handling other urgent matters. However, your report is logged and reviewed by the appropriate investigative unit. They will follow up if they need more details or if your information leads to a development. The goal of the Alachua County Sheriff's Office Phone Line for Crime Tips and Emergencies is to create a record and act on intelligence, not necessarily to provide real-time case updates to every caller.

Things People Often Misunderstand
One of the biggest myths is that calling this number will result in immediate police intervention at your door. This is simply not how non-emergency lines operate. The Alachua County Sheriff's Office Phone Line for Crime Tips and Emergencies is not a direct line for urgent help; it is a line for information. Another common misunderstanding is that you will be tracked or identified easily if you choose to remain anonymous. Modern protocols are designed to protect tipsters who do not give out personal details, allowing them to contribute safely.
Some people also believe that their small tip is not valuable. In reality, law enforcement often looks for small anomalies that do not seem significant on their own but become crucial when combined with other reports. A single voice reporting a quiet suspicious event might be the missing piece of a larger puzzle. By understanding the reality of how these systems work, the public can trust the process and feel more comfortable using this important civic resource.
